The cost of going off-grid in Nigeria: From ₦400,000

For ₦5 million, a 5kVA hybrid solar system provides an even more robust solution. This system has a 5kW hybrid inverter, a 5kWh lithium-iron phosphate battery, and 4.5kWh mono half-cut solar panels. It can support a
